As we pull up stakes on the Plains of San Augustin and wrap up our time with the Karl G. Jansky Very Large Array, let's take a quick pit stop to reflect on our journey so far and set the stage for what's coming next on the Enchanted Frequencies Mission to New Mexico.

In this interlude episode, I preview the next leg of the expedition:

  • 🏔️ Magdalena Ridge Observatory Interferometer (MROI): Bleeding-edge optical and infrared astronomy at 10,600 feet.
  • 📡 The Long Wavelength Array (LWA): Listening to the universe at the lowest radio frequencies from vast fields of dipole antennas.
  • 🎓 University of New Mexico Observatory: Bridging academic science, student training, and community stargazing.
  • 🔭 The Grand Finale with John Briggs: A marathon sit-down with the astronomical historian and founder of the Magdalena Astronomical Lyceum.
